The Malvern Bay
This curved ‘lead’ effect bay has an integral gutter with outlet positions that can be easily drilled for either a left or right hand down pipe. Suitable for windows dimensions 1880 - 2000mm wide and 745 – 685mm projection.
Overall width 2320 mm
Soffit width 2080 mm
Soffit projection 785 mm
Roof Height 695 mm.

The Chillingham Bay
This curved ‘lead’ effect bay has an integral gutter with outlet positions that can be easily drilled for either a left or right hand down pipe. It was originally designed for a window/door combination built within a cavity wall bay. It therefore has a wider soffit width, allowing greater flexibility to the window size. Suitable for windows dimensions 2350 - 2550mm wide and 600 –500mm projection.
Overall width 2688 mm
Overall projection 671 mm
Soffit width 2630 mm
Soffit projection 642mm.

The Radleigh Bay
This curved ‘lead’ effect bay has an integral gutter with outlet positions that can be easily drilled for either a left or right hand down pipe. Suitable for windows dimensions 2450 - 2570mm wide and 745 – 685mm projection.
Overall width 2722 mm
Overall projection 815
Soffit width 2650 mm
Soffit projection 785 mm
Roof Height 880 mm.
